Description
The printing routine prihre is called from zgr_zps in the domzgr module with hardwired arguments. Those arguments seem to specify which section of an array to print. Depending on the processor grid being used, it is possible that processor 0 will not have that section of the array and therefore the WRITE statements within prihre are referencing elements beyond the declared bounds of the array.
See e.g. line 408 of domzgr_zps.h90.
